The principal purpose of the present paper is to report about a new magnetospheric reconnection structure arising for the near-radial interplanetary magnetic field (IMF) orientations. This structure includes simultaneous existence of two modes of the solar wind-magnetosphere coupling (two- and three-dimensional reconnections). For the southward IMF two two-dimensional merging sites exist: one on the noon equatorial magnetopause and the other in the magnetotail. Reconnection takes place along merging line connecting them. As IMF rotates from southward toward a radial orientation, the merging site where lobe fields reconnect becomes three-dimensional and moves from the tail to the high-latitude dayside magnetosphere (northward for IMF Bx>0 and southward for IMF Bx<0), while the merging site where interplanetary and closed field lines reconnect remains two-dimensional and shifts along the magnetopause from subsolar point to the south for IMF Bx>0 and to the north for IMF Bx<0. In the vicinity of two-dimensional magnetic null on the magnetopause, reconnection occurs at merging line simultaneously with the three-dimensional reconnection at the second neutral point in the magnetosphere. For the strong northward IMF two three-dimensional merging sites exist in the cusp regions of the magnetosphere. Proposed construction is supported by calculations in the paraboloid magnetospheric model.
